System Status Panel
The
System Status
panel displays the identification data and status of the
CDU(s) in the AviMet system. In duplicated systems there is a status row
for each CDU, in single-CDU system there is only one status row.
The icon in the
Heartbeat
column is normally green. Red icon indicates a
system problem. Similarly, red color in the
Missing processes
column
indicates problems.
